What Is the Cost of Living Near Tampa?

Understanding the cost of living near Tampa is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Leisure Homes.
Tampa's Cost of Living Index is approximately 100.1 (0.1% more expensive than US average; 2.9% less than FL average). Growing Gulf Coast city, housing costs near US average but have risen.
